Jockey Performance: More Than a Win‑Percentage

Look: a rider’s win % tells a story, but the plot thickens with place and show percentages, surface preferences, and post‑position mastery. A jockey who thrives on turf might flounder on dirt, so slicing the data by track type can turn a mediocre bet into a gold mine.

Short, sharp fact: a rider with a 15% win rate on a specific course often outperforms a higher‑overall rider who’s never won there. That’s the kind of edge you chase.

Trainer Trends: The Silent Architect

Trainers are the architects of a horse’s form. Their prep routines, breed selections, and race‑day tactics leave fingerprints on the final time. A trainer who consistently hits a 10% win rate in stakes races is a signal flare you can’t ignore.

Here’s the deal: some trainers specialize in sprint distances, others in marathon routes. Mixing those specialties with the jockey’s strength creates a synergy that the casual bettor rarely spots.

Timing Is Everything

Recent form trumps historical data. A jockey who’s on a hot streak—three consecutive wins—will often ride a horse with higher confidence, translating into a better odds‑to‑payout ratio. Same for trainers who’ve cracked a winning formula in the last month.

And here is why: the betting market reacts slower to emerging trends than to established records. Jump on the wave early, and the odds you face are still soft.

Practical Application for the Sharp Bettor

Grab a spreadsheet. List each horse’s jockey win % by surface, the trainer’s win % by distance, then overlay the last five races for each combo. Highlight any pair that exceeds the field average by at least two points. Those are your high‑probability tickets.
